How Discover the Fort Smith AR Jail Inmate Search Process Actually Works

The Discover the Fort Smith AR Jail Inmate Search Process typically involves a straightforward online portal maintained by the local detention facility or county sheriffโ€™s office. Users begin by visiting the official website and locating the inmate search tool, which may require minimal details such as a name or booking number. The system then pulls data from internal records and displays relevant information, including custody status, charges, and scheduled court dates. It is important to note that results are based on official database entries and may be updated periodically throughout the day. For those new to this process, exploring the search feature with a test name can help build familiarity and confidence in its functionality.

Understanding Data Limitations and Update Frequency

It is essential to recognize that the information retrieved through Discover the Fort Smith AR Jail Inmate Search Process reflects database snapshots rather than real-time updates. Records may lag due to processing times, court schedule changes, or administrative workflows. For example, an inmate listed as "in custody" might have been recently transferred, released, or moved to a different facility, with the database only reflecting that change after verification. Users should treat the search results as a useful reference point, but not as a substitute for directly contacting the jail or court for the most current status. Clear documentation about update cycles is often available within the search tool itself, promoting realistic expectations.

Things People Often Misunderstand

A common misconception is that the Discover the Fort Smith AR Jail Inmate Search Process provides a complete criminal history, when in reality it typically shows only current or recent custodial information. Arrests that did not lead to charges, cases that were dismissed, or records that have been sealed are generally not included. Another misunderstanding is that the data is updated continuously in real time; as noted earlier, there are often administrative delays. Some users also assume that the system reflects guilt or innocence, but it merely reports detention status and charges as recorded by authorities. By clarifying these points, the public can engage with the tool more thoughtfully and avoid drawing premature conclusions.
